

Julieta (48) lives in Lisbon, numb and unsatisfied, with her husband and two children. She works as a film producer and leads a frenetic life, prone to self-destruction and substance abuse. After 15 years of marriage, her husband leaves her, and Julieta, disoriented and depressed, has to deal simultaneously with the divorce, her father’s illness, a bipolar mother, and the challenges of balancing motherhood with a career without routines - and with her tendency to live on the edge, between danger and adventure. To avoid collapse, Julieta must confront her fears, anxiety, and addictions. Her encounter with Tantric practices sparks a journey of self-discovery and erotic and sexual exploration, offering her new perspectives on the transformative potential of the body and sexuality in the process of grieving and stepping into a new life cycle.
Director: Filipa Reis
Produced by: Uma Pedra no Sapato (PT)
Coproduced by: KG Productions (FR), Amore Cine (ES), Desvia (BR)
Financed by: ICA, Ibermedia, MEDIA - Creative Europe
